1 instantiation of ProjectContext
Microsoft.NET.Build.Tasks (1)
LockFileExtensions.cs (1)
89return new ProjectContext(lockFile, lockFileTarget, platformLibrary,
19 references to ProjectContext
Microsoft.NET.Build.Tasks (12)
AssetsFileResolver.cs (1)
32public IEnumerable<ResolvedFile> Resolve(ProjectContext projectContext, bool resolveRuntimeTargets = true)
DependencyContextBuilder.cs (1)
52public DependencyContextBuilder(SingleProjectInfo mainProjectInfo, bool includeRuntimeFileVersions, RuntimeGraph runtimeGraph, ProjectContext projectContext, LockFileLookup libraryLookup)
FilterResolvedFiles.cs (1)
57ProjectContext projectContext = lockFile.CreateProjectContext(
GenerateDepsFile.cs (1)
138ProjectContext projectContext = null;
GenerateRuntimeConfigurationFiles.cs (4)
124RuntimeFrameworks.Select(r => new ProjectContext.RuntimeFramework(r)).ToArray(), 132ProjectContext projectContext = lockFile.CreateProjectContext( 152ProjectContext.RuntimeFramework[] runtimeFrameworks, 184ProjectContext.RuntimeFramework[] runtimeFrameworks,
LockFileExtensions.cs (2)
65public static ProjectContext CreateProjectContext( 90runtimeFrameworks?.Select(i => new ProjectContext.RuntimeFramework(i))?.ToArray(),
ResolveCopyLocalAssets.cs (1)
59ProjectContext projectContext = lockFile.CreateProjectContext(
ResolvePackageAssets.cs (1)
1930var topLevelDependencies = ProjectContext.GetTopLevelDependencies(_lockFile, _runtimeTarget);
Microsoft.NET.Build.Tasks.UnitTests (7)
GivenADependencyContextBuilder.cs (4)
57ProjectContext projectContext = lockFile.CreateProjectContext( 240ProjectContext projectContext = lockFile.CreateProjectContext( 440ProjectContext projectContext = lockFile.CreateProjectContext( 492ProjectContext projectContext = lockFile.CreateProjectContext(
GivenAnAssetsFileResolver.cs (2)
25ProjectContext projectContext = lockFile.CreateProjectContext( 45ProjectContext projectContext = lockFile.CreateProjectContext(
GivenAProjectContext.cs (1)
19ProjectContext projectContext = lockFile.CreateProjectContext(